How a $1,500 Debt Consolidation Loan Works

Debt consolidation involves using one new loan to pay off several smaller debts. Instead of juggling multiple minimum payments, you make a single, consistent monthly payment until the loan is repaid. This structure helps reduce missed payments, simplify budgeting, and improve long term financial stability.

A $1,500 consolidation loan is ideal for borrowers with scattered balances across credit cards, buy now pay later accounts, medical statements, or small personal loans. How Much Can You Save With Debt Consolidation

Your savings will depend on the interest rates of your existing debts and the APR of your consolidation loan. Many borrowers reduce the monthly load by replacing high interest credit cards with a fixed rate installment loan. Even if your consolidation APR is not significantly lower, the structured repayment timeline helps you pay off debt faster.

  • A single fixed payment reduces missed payments and late fees
  • Fixed terms keep you from adding new balances on revolving accounts
  • Predictable interest costs make budgeting easier
  • You may reduce total interest by paying off high rate accounts sooner

How to Use a $1,500 Loan to Consolidate Debt

Once approved, funds are typically deposited directly into your bank account. From there, you can pay off each debt individually. This ensures your accounts are closed or fully paid, preventing additional interest from accumulating.

Steps include:

  • List all your outstanding balances
  • Verify payoff amounts from each creditor
  • Use your consolidation funds to pay each account
  • Create a single repayment schedule for your new loan
  • Focus on consistent monthly payments
